All Resorts.1-25-12

High pressure will slide off to the east today.  We’ll see mild-ish temperatures and a good bit of sunshine once again.  It should be a fun day to get some turns in.

Clouds will begin to increase late this afternoon and evening as a warm front approaches from the south.  Scattered showers begin to pop up overnight.  The front will slide north across the region tomorrow, meaning widespread showers are in the forecast unfortunately.

Showers continue through the morning hours on Friday as a cold front passes through the region.  We should see any leftover precip taper off by midday though.

Weak high pressure then builds in for Friday and Saturday.  Temps will be colder, but not bone chilling by any means.

Another cold front passes through Saturday night.  This one will bring much colder air with it into the region.  Highs on Sunday look to be very chilly as we’ll see around the clock snowmaking at many of the ski areas.
